Output cc54b942efb77bd20aeae5f22c6549dbdb288cc2153b9a6297e0bf93b3c96223:115

value
2574354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f27a9afefd4fe26b4988fd6a8547d2fcc3619526 OP_EQUAL
address
3Po8Kk3ZUmWiDiYXy5BegzL85pDMfkyezs
transaction
cc54b942efb77bd20aeae5f22c6549dbdb288cc2153b9a6297e0bf93b3c96223
confirmations
158328
spent
true